From 2b7276b2892b6f090e4c0078a20dfdc9da9ab053 Mon Sep 17 00:00:00 2001 From: duheng <2286773002@qq.com> Date: 星期四, 13 三月 2025 10:32:54 +0800 Subject: [PATCH] --基础界面修改初步提交 --- WinFrmUI/PBS.WinFrmUI/01-place/PlaceMgrPage.cs | 120 ++++++++++++++++++++++++++++++----------------------------- 1 files changed, 61 insertions(+), 59 deletions(-) diff --git a/WinFrmUI/PBS.WinFrmUI/01-place/PlaceMgrPage.cs b/WinFrmUI/PBS.WinFrmUI/01-place/PlaceMgrPage.cs index 4d565c8..672decd 100644 --- a/WinFrmUI/PBS.WinFrmUI/01-place/PlaceMgrPage.cs +++ b/WinFrmUI/PBS.WinFrmUI/01-place/PlaceMgrPage.cs @@ -10,6 +10,7 @@ public PlaceMgrPage() { InitializeComponent(); + this.gridView1.SetNormalView(30); } private List<PlaceViewModel> _allBindingList; @@ -39,80 +40,81 @@ //鏂板灏忓尯 private void btnAddBuilding_ItemClick(object sender, DevExpress.XtraBars.ItemClickEventArgs e) { - /* var dlg = new AddPlaceDlg(); - dlg.SetBindingData("Build"); - dlg.ReloadDataEvent += async (Vmo) => - { - var id = await _placeBll.Insert(Vmo); - if (id > 0) - { - _allBindingList.Add(new PlaceViewModel(Vmo)); - this.placeViewModelBindingSource.ResetBindings(false); - return true; - } - return false; - }; - dlg.ShowDialog(); - */ + var dlg = new AddPlaceDlg(); + dlg.SetBindingData(HStation.PBS.ePlaceType.Build); + dlg.ReloadDataEvent += async (Vmo) => + { + var id = await _placeBll.Insert(Vmo); + if (id > 0) + { + Vmo.ID = id; + _allBindingList.Add(new PlaceViewModel(Vmo)); + this.placeViewModelBindingSource.ResetBindings(false); + return true; + } + return false; + }; + dlg.ShowDialog(); } //鏂板瀛︽牎 private void btnAddschool_ItemClick(object sender, DevExpress.XtraBars.ItemClickEventArgs e) { - /* var dlg = new AddPlaceDlg(); - dlg.SetBindingData("School"); - dlg.ReloadDataEvent += async (Vmo) => - { - var id = await _placeBll.Insert(Vmo); - if (id > 0) - { - _allBindingList.Add(new PlaceViewModel(Vmo)); - this.placeViewModelBindingSource.ResetBindings(false); - return true; - } - return false; - }; - dlg.ShowDialog();*/ + var dlg = new AddPlaceDlg(); + dlg.SetBindingData(HStation.PBS.ePlaceType.School); + dlg.ReloadDataEvent += async (Vmo) => + { + var id = await _placeBll.Insert(Vmo); + if (id > 0) + { + Vmo.ID = id; + _allBindingList.Add(new PlaceViewModel(Vmo)); + this.placeViewModelBindingSource.ResetBindings(false); + return true; + } + return false; + }; + dlg.ShowDialog(); } //鏂板鍖婚櫌 private void btnAddHospital_ItemClick(object sender, DevExpress.XtraBars.ItemClickEventArgs e) { - /* var dlg = new AddPlaceDlg(); - dlg.SetBindingData("Hospital"); - dlg.ReloadDataEvent += async (Vmo) => - { - var id = await _placeBll.Insert(Vmo); - if (id > 0) - { - _allBindingList.Add(new PlaceViewModel(Vmo)); - this.placeViewModelBindingSource.ResetBindings(false); - return true; - } - return false; - }; - dlg.ShowDialog(); - */ + var dlg = new AddPlaceDlg(); + dlg.SetBindingData(HStation.PBS.ePlaceType.Hospital); + dlg.ReloadDataEvent += async (Vmo) => + { + var id = await _placeBll.Insert(Vmo); + if (id > 0) + { + Vmo.ID = id; + _allBindingList.Add(new PlaceViewModel(Vmo)); + this.placeViewModelBindingSource.ResetBindings(false); + return true; + } + return false; + }; + dlg.ShowDialog(); } //鏂板鍟嗛摵 private void btnAddShop_ItemClick(object sender, DevExpress.XtraBars.ItemClickEventArgs e) { - /* var dlg = new AddPlaceDlg(); - dlg.SetBindingData("Shop"); - dlg.ReloadDataEvent += async (Vmo) => - { - var id = await _placeBll.Insert(Vmo); - if (id > 0) - { - _allBindingList.Add(new PlaceViewModel(Vmo)); - this.placeViewModelBindingSource.ResetBindings(false); - return true; - } - return false; - }; - dlg.ShowDialog(); - */ + var dlg = new AddPlaceDlg(); + dlg.SetBindingData(HStation.PBS.ePlaceType.Shop); + dlg.ReloadDataEvent += async (Vmo) => + { + var id = await _placeBll.Insert(Vmo); + if (id > 0) + { + Vmo.ID = id; + _allBindingList.Add(new PlaceViewModel(Vmo)); + this.placeViewModelBindingSource.ResetBindings(false); + return true; + } + return false; + }; + dlg.ShowDialog(); } //鍒犻櫎 -- Gitblit v1.9.3